Understanding Biostimulators

Biostimulators, often derived from natural sources, enhance plant growth by stimulating their metabolism, improving nutrient uptake and resilience to stresses. By using biostimulator injectables, farmers can ensure that their crops are provided with the essential nutrients they need at critical stages of development. This leads to healthier plants that can survive adverse conditions and thrive, ultimately resulting in higher yields. Interestingly, this approach also aligns with environmentally friendly practices, which are crucial in today’s agricultural landscape.

The Advantages of Using Injectables

The key benefits of biostimulator injectables lie in their ability to deliver nutrients directly to the plants system, ensuring an efficient uptake. Traditional fertilizers can often result in wastage due to runoff and evaporation. In contrast, injectables provide a targeted application, reducing environmental impacts while maximizing growth potential. This innovative method not only promotes sustainable practices but provides an effective solution to enhancing crop yields. Implementation in Crops

Implementing biostimulator injectables requires proper understanding and strategy. Farmers should focus on selecting the right biostimulator based on their specific crop types and the local climate. Additionally, timing the application is vital for achieving maximum efficacy. For instance, applying these injectables during crucial growth phases can significantly enhance the crop’s potential, resulting in notable increases in productivity.

FAQs

1. How safe are biostimulator injectables for the environment?
Biostimulators are typically derived from natural sources and are designed to enhance plant growth without harmful side effects. They often contribute to sustainable practices by reducing the need for chemical fertilizers.

2. Can biostimulators replace traditional fertilizers?
While biostimulators can enhance nutrient uptake and improve plant resilience, they are often used in conjunction with traditional fertilizers to optimize results.
